HUBER+SUHNER is a global company with headquarters in Switzerland which develops and manufactures components and system solutions for electrical and optical connectivity. With cables, connectors and systems – developed from the three core technologies of radio frequency, fiber optics and low frequency – the company serves customers in the transportation (especially Railways and Bus), communication and industrial sectors. The products deliver high performance, quality, reliability and long life – even under harsh environment conditions. Our global production network, combined with group companies and agencies in over 80 countries, puts HUBER+SUHNER close to its customers. RAILWAY SOLUTIONS
HUBER+SUHNER is the leading supplier of cables and cable systems and offers application-specific connectivity solutions for the construction of modern railway vehicles and related infrastructure. The requirements of today's rail industry include high levels of safety, reliability, energy efficiency and comfort. Moreover, rail passengers are being offered an increasing number of extras such as information services and Internet access.

Products from HUBER+SUHNER are specially developed to meet the requirements of the railway sector based on three different technologies: Low Frequency, Radio Frequency and Fiber Optics. For all three technologies HUBER+SUHNER provides customised kits and pre-assembled cable systems.

SENCITY® RAIL ACTIVE ANTENNA for for Train-to ground communication
SENCITY® RAIL ACTIVE
The first-of-its-kind omni-directional, broadband rooftop antenna has an integrated connected compute module, cellular radios, Wi-Fi access point and GNSS receiver. It provides power and data via a single ethernet cable and is designed to meet the special requirements of railway applications, including high current and high voltage protection.
Features

Railway rooftop omni-directional antenna with integrated compute module and radios.

Power and Data provided via a single PoE+ M12 X-Pol cable assembly.

4x4 MIMO 4G and 5G integrated radio options connected to separate antenna elements.

2x2 MIMO Wi-Fi access point connected to separate antenna elements.

L1 Multibands GNSS antenna and receiver

Certified for Railway standards EN 50155, EN 45545-2 and NFPA-130

Benefits

Integrated product simplifies deployment of 4x4 MIMO train-to-ground systems on trains.

ARM based compute module allows users to deploy application software directly on the antenna.

No RF cables required.

Applications

Railway rooftop train-to-ground communication
